Output d57cbd5e6d06db8caed5aadb66eb5205b2c31b54a57f414c8c000a6cc2a6d721:58

value
536648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59cd39bf8f406b1583cd401df7c192d15eeb3827 OP_EQUALVERIFY OP_CHECKSIG
address
19BpzPybWnuU67QkbToiM8jAHFL7BEAYk3
transaction
d57cbd5e6d06db8caed5aadb66eb5205b2c31b54a57f414c8c000a6cc2a6d721
confirmations
156108
spent
true